A typical Cisco 6840 datasheet will contain details such as:
- Switching capacity and throughput
- Number and type of ports (e.g., Gigabit Ethernet, 10 Gigabit Ethernet)
- Power consumption and cooling requirements
- Supported software features (e.g., VLANs, routing protocols, security features)
These specifications directly influence the switch’s ability to handle network traffic, support different devices, and integrate into existing infrastructure. For example, a higher switching capacity allows the switch to handle more simultaneous connections without performance degradation.
